Milling equipment

Four-axis CNC milling machines are used for milling wax models, allowing all basic tasks to be performed with high precision. The result is a three-dimensional model of the future product with a high degree of detail and accuracy.

Maximum machining area along the axes:

We mill any wax patterns that do not exceed the working area of the milling cutter.

  • Axis x – 160 mm.
  • Axis y – 90 mm.
  • Axis z – 140 mm.
  • Axis a – 360°.

Stages of milling model wax

From digital concept to flawless form: discover how we transform your STL file into a high-precision jewelry wax model.

Preparation and analysis of 3D models

In the first stage, we import your STL file into the CAM system. We check the integrity of the polygonal mesh, analyze the geometry for the presence of “undercuts” (areas inaccessible to the milling cutter) and, if necessary, make adjustments for a perfect result.

Selecting a strategy and tool

We select a cutting tool individually for each part. This is usually a cascading approach: end mills for quick removal of excess volume and precision conical or spherical mills for detailed relief work.

Trajectory programming (CAM)

We create a control program, calculating each step of the tool's movement. At this stage, the cutting modes are set: spindle speed and feed rate, which guarantees a clean surface and prevents the material from overheating.

Virtual simulation

Before starting the machine, the program undergoes a digital check. We simulate the machining process on a computer to completely eliminate the risk of collisions, workpiece jamming, or tool breakage. This guarantees safety and precision.

CNC milling

The workpiece is securely fixed in place, and the automatic process is started. The process consists of two stages: roughing (removing the bulk of the material) and finishing (forming the final texture with microscopic steps for maximum smoothness).

Final finishing and inspection

After removal from the machine, the product undergoes manual or abrasive processing: removal of technological bridges, grinding, and verification of compliance with the dimensions of the original file. The finished product fully complies with your digital drawing.
